/** * Related Posts Loader for Astra theme. * * @package Astra * @author Brainstorm Force * @copyright Copyright (c) 2021,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.5.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.5.0 */ class Astra_Related_Posts_Loader { /** * Constructor * * @since 3.5.0 */ public function __construct() { add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_action( 'customize_register', array( $this, 'related_posts_customize_register' ), 2 ); // Load Google fonts. add_action( 'astra_get_fonts', array( $this, 'add_fonts' ), 1 ); } /** * Enqueue google fonts. * * @return void */ public function add_fonts() { if ( astra_target_rules_for_related_posts() ) { // Related Posts Section title. $section_title_font_family = astra_get_option( 'related-posts-section-title-font-family' ); $section_title_font_weight = astra_get_option( 'related-posts-section-title-font-weight' ); Astra_Fonts::add_font( $section_title_font_family, $section_title_font_weight ); // Related Posts - Posts title. $post_title_font_family = astra_get_option( 'related-posts-title-font-family' ); $post_title_font_weight = astra_get_option( 'related-posts-title-font-weight' ); Astra_Fonts::add_font( $post_title_font_family, $post_title_font_weight ); // Related Posts - Meta Font. $meta_font_family = astra_get_option( 'related-posts-meta-font-family' ); $meta_font_weight = astra_get_option( 'related-posts-meta-font-weight' ); Astra_Fonts::add_font( $meta_font_family, $meta_font_weight ); // Related Posts - Content Font. $content_font_family = astra_get_option( 'related-posts-content-font-family' ); $content_font_weight = astra_get_option( 'related-posts-content-font-weight' ); Astra_Fonts::add_font( $content_font_family, $content_font_weight ); } } /** * Set Options Default Values * * @param array $defaults Astra options default value array. * @return array */ public function theme_defaults( $defaults ) { // Related Posts. $defaults['enable-related-posts'] = false; $defaults['related-posts-title'] = __( 'Related Posts', 'astra' ); $defaults['releted-posts-title-alignment'] = 'left'; $defaults['related-posts-total-count'] = 2; $defaults['enable-related-posts-excerpt'] = false; $defaults['related-posts-excerpt-count'] = 25; $defaults['related-posts-based-on'] = 'categories'; $defaults['related-posts-order-by'] = 'date'; $defaults['related-posts-order'] = 'asc'; $defaults['related-posts-grid-responsive'] = array( 'desktop' => '2-equal', 'tablet' => '2-equal', 'mobile' => 'full', ); $defaults['related-posts-structure'] = array( 'featured-image', 'title-meta', ); $defaults['related-posts-meta-structure'] = array( 'comments', 'category', 'author', ); // Related Posts - Color styles. $defaults['related-posts-text-color'] = ''; $defaults['related-posts-link-color'] = ''; $defaults['related-posts-title-color'] = ''; $defaults['related-posts-background-color'] = ''; $defaults['related-posts-meta-color'] = ''; $defaults['related-posts-link-hover-color'] = ''; $defaults['related-posts-meta-link-hover-color'] = ''; // Related Posts - Title typo. $defaults['related-posts-section-title-font-family'] = 'inherit'; $defaults['related-posts-section-title-font-weight'] = 'inherit'; $defaults['related-posts-section-title-text-transform'] = ''; $defaults['related-posts-section-title-line-height'] = ''; $defaults['related-posts-section-title-font-size'] = array( 'desktop' => '30',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Title typo. $defaults['related-posts-title-font-family'] = 'inherit'; $defaults['related-posts-title-font-weight'] = 'inherit'; $defaults['related-posts-title-text-transform'] = ''; $defaults['related-posts-title-line-height'] = '1'; $defaults['related-posts-title-font-size'] = array( 'desktop' => '20',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Meta typo. $defaults['related-posts-meta-font-family'] = 'inherit'; $defaults['related-posts-meta-font-weight'] = 'inherit'; $defaults['related-posts-meta-text-transform'] = ''; $defaults['related-posts-meta-line-height'] = ''; $defaults['related-posts-meta-font-size'] = array( 'desktop' => '14',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); // Related Posts - Content typo. $defaults['related-posts-content-font-family'] = 'inherit'; $defaults['related-posts-content-font-weight'] = 'inherit'; $defaults['related-posts-content-text-transform'] = ''; $defaults['related-posts-content-line-height'] = ''; $defaults['related-posts-content-font-size'] = array( 'desktop' => '', 'tablet' => '', 'mobile' => '', 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); return $defaults; } /** * Add postMessage support for site title and description for the Theme Customizer. * * @param WP_Customize_Manager $wp_customize Theme Customizer object. * * @since 3.5.0 */ public function related_posts_customize_register( $wp_customize ) { /** * Register Config control in Related Posts. */ //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_RELATED_POSTS_DIR . 'customizer/class-astra-related-posts-configs.php'; //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} /** * Render the Related Posts title for the selective refresh partial. * * @since 3.5.0 */ public function render_related_posts_title() { return astra_get_option( 'related-posts-title' ); } } /** * Kicking this off by creating NEW instace. */ new Astra_Related_Posts_Loader(); Progressive Jackpots: How to Win Big – Quality Formación

Progressive Jackpots: How to Win Big

Why Progressive Jackpots: How to Win Big Matters

Progressive jackpots have transformed the gambling landscape, offering players the chance to win life-changing sums of money. Unlike standard jackpots, which remain fixed until won, progressive jackpots increase every time a bet is placed. This dynamic creates a thrilling atmosphere and attracts players seeking high-stakes excitement. Understanding how to strategically approach these games can significantly enhance your chances of hitting the big win.

The Mechanics of Progressive Jackpots

Progressive jackpots function through a small percentage of each wager contributing to the jackpot pool. Here’s how it typically works:

– **Initial Seed**: The jackpot starts with a base amount, often around **£1,000**.
– **Contribution Rate**: Usually, **1% – 5%** of every player’s bet goes towards the jackpot.
– **Growth Pattern**: As more players wager, the jackpot grows exponentially until it is won.

This model means that the potential payout can reach staggering amounts, often exceeding **£1 million** in popular games.

The Math Behind Winning Progressive Jackpots

Understanding the numbers is crucial. Here’s a simplified breakdown of the Return to Player (RTP) and wagering requirements:

Game Type RTP (%) Wagering Requirement
Standard Slots 92% – 96% 20x – 40x
Progressive Slots 85% – 90% 30x – 50x
Live Casino Progressive 90% – 95% 35x

A lower RTP can be intimidating, but the potential for massive payouts can outweigh this factor. The key is to balance your bankroll against the risk and reward scenario.

Strategies for Maximizing Your Odds

To enhance your chances of winning a progressive jackpot, consider the following strategies:

  • Bet Max: Many progressive slots require maximum bets to qualify for the jackpot. This can often mean wagering anywhere from **£1 to £5** per spin.
  • Choose the Right Games: Not all progressive jackpots are equal. Research games with a higher payout history.
  • Manage Your Bankroll: Set strict limits for your playtime and spending to avoid chasing losses.
  • Utilize Bonuses Wisely: Take advantage of welcome bonuses and free spins, particularly those that do not have high wagering requirements.

Hidden Risks in Progressive Jackpots

While the allure of massive jackpots is enticing, it’s essential to be aware of the hidden risks associated with these games:

– **Lower RTP**: As highlighted earlier, the average RTP for progressive slots is notably lower than traditional slots.
– **Chasing Losses**: The potential for big wins can lead to reckless betting behavior, resulting in significant losses.
– **Time Commitment**: Winning a progressive jackpot often requires extended gameplay, which can lead to fatigue and poor decisions.

Real-Life Winners: Case Studies

Examining real-life cases of progressive jackpot winners can provide valuable insights. For instance, in 2021, a player won **£7.5 million** on a popular online slot after wagering just **£2**. This win sparked debates about the feasibility of such jackpots and the strategies employed by winners.

Conclusion: The Thrill Awaits

Progressive jackpots offer an unparalleled thrill for serious gamblers. By understanding the mechanics, employing strategic betting practices, and being aware of the risks, players can navigate these games more effectively. With every spin, the chance to win big is just around the corner, especially when playing at platforms like Bloody Slots slots.

monopoly casino